In an era where environmental themes are more critical than ever, Claudia Dávila’s graphic novel Luz Sees the Light stands out as a vibrant, essential resource for young readers. Part of the "Future According to Luz" series, this book tackles complex issues like fossil fuel dependence and sustainable living through the eyes of a spirited 12-year-old protagonist.
